Transaction eb95eb6b8f23ff35617182e9bcf69d8a1116626e0125ddda08bdede7a73bab41
1 Input
1 Output
-
eb95eb6b8f23ff35617182e9bcf69d8a1116626e0125ddda08bdede7a73bab41:0
- value
- 18101765
- script pubkey
- OP_0 OP_PUSHBYTES_20 e38db948019ccb1ea12287776ecc148e961b674d
- address
- bc1quwxmjjqpnn93agfzsamkanq536tpke6dmm9xjz